Refreshed for the 2022 model year, the Chevrolet Equinox is the best compact SUV for quality, according to its owners. It comes in four trim levels, each equipped with a turbocharged 4-cylinder engine and FWD. An AWD system is optional. The Equinox carries five people, and cargo space ranges from 29.9 cubic feet behind the back seat to 63.9 cubic feet with the rear seat folded down. The EPA says the 2022 Equinox will return between 27 mpg and 28 mpg in combined driving.
Equipped with seating for up to eight people and anywhere between 25.5 and 122.9 cubic feet of cargo space, the Chevy Tahoe is the best full-size SUV for quality this year. Six trim levels range from basic to luxurious, and for 2022 Chevrolet added a new infotainment system running Google Built-in technology. Buyers can choose between two gas-fueled V8 engines and a turbocharged diesel 6-cylinder, and 4WD is optional. The V8 engines return between 16 mpg and 17 mpg in combined driving, while the turbodiesel averages 22-24 mpg. The Tahoe is a traditional body-on-frame SUV that can tow up to 8,400 pounds when properly equipped.
With the return of the Grand Wagoneer nameplate to the Jeep lineup, the brand is going head-to-head with other large premium SUV models. Based on what Grand Wagoneer owners say, the plush new 3-row Jeep is mighty satisfying. Four trim levels are available, each equipped with standard 4WD. A V8 engine is standard, and Jeep recently added a new twin-turbocharged inline 6-cylinder engine as an option. Fuel economy ranges from 15 to 17 mpg in combined driving, and the Grand Wagoneer is one of the best SUVs for towing, thanks to its maximum rating of 9,850 pounds. Cargo space ranges between 27.4 and 94.2 cubic feet.
On paper, this is a tie between the Mercedes-Benz GLE 350de plug-in hybrid diesel, and the just-arriving new BMW X1 xDrive25e, both of offer 353mpg on the combined WLTP fuel economy test. Of course, that relies on you carefully charging up all the time and making the most of their electric driving abilities. For real-world economy, your best bets at the Toyota RAV4 (especially the plug-in hybrid version), the Mazda CX-5 SkyActiv-D, and at the smaller scale, the Peugeot 2008, which can hit 47mpg in petrol form, and an official 65mpg in diesel form.

That's where the What Car Reliability Survey comes in. With data from nearly 13,000 car owners, we've rated 175 models from 31 brands. For each car, we asked if it had suffered any faults in the previous 12 months, and if so, in which of 14 different areas: air-con, battery, bodywork, brakes, engine, engine electrics, fuel system, exhaust system, gearbox/clutch, infotainment/dashboard, interior trim, non-engine electrics, steering and suspension.

Really, any Subaru bar the BRZ and Legacy could arguably find a place on this list, but it's the brand's latest model, the Outback Wilderness (which starts at $38,445) that deserves it most. Building on the already impressive turbocharged Outback XT, the Wilderness adds ground clearance (standing 9.5 inches off the ground) and off-road capability without compromising the excellent cargo space (33 cubic feet with the seats up, 76 with the seats down) and other traits that make the Outback such a great ride.
